Dr. John J. Mercuri is an Adult Reconstruction Surgeon at Geisinger specializing in advanced knee and hip replacements using robotics and computer navigation. A native of Scranton, he returned to his hometown to practice. He serves as the Director of the Geisinger Adult Reconstruction Fellowship and is an associate professor at Geisinger Commonwealth School of Medicine.

Outside of work, he is a former collegiate long-distance runner who still enjoys running. He spends his personal time with his wife and two sons and also enjoys doing yard work with his antique John Deere farm tractor. His humanitarian efforts include a surgical relief trip to Haiti.

Interesting fact: Dr. Mercuri was inducted into The University of Scrantons athletic Wall of Fame for his achievements as a long-distance runner.
